Cost of Living: Hartford vs Chicago (2026)

A one-bedroom apartment runs $1,700/mo in Hartford vs $1,900/mo in Chicago โ€” a 11% difference. Chicago has a lower state income tax rate (4.9% vs 7%), which adds up over time.

  • 1BR rent: $1,700/mo in Hartford vs $1,900/mo โ€” 11% savings
  • Higher median household income: Chicago ($67,000/yr vs $60,000/yr)
  • Median home price: $310,000 in Hartford vs $360,000 โ€” 14% difference

Frequently asked questions

What is the average rent in Hartford vs Chicago?

As of Q1 2026, the median 1-bedroom rent in Hartford is $1,700/month and in Chicago is $1,900/month. Hartford is cheaper by 11%.

How much do I need to earn in Chicago to match a $75,000 salary in Hartford?

To maintain a similar lifestyle, you would need approximately $75,000/year in Chicago to match a $75,000 salary in Hartford. This estimate is based on overall cost of living indices and does not account for individual spending patterns.

Which city has lower taxes โ€” Hartford or Chicago?

Chicago has the lower state income tax rate at 4.9% vs 7%. The difference is 2.1 percentage points. Note that sales tax and local taxes also vary โ€” see the full breakdown in the table above.
